Refined Optical Performance

The STM7 series uses the same UIS2 infinity-corrected optical system found in state-of-the-art optical microscopes.
As a result, observed images have high resolution and high contrast, with aberration thoroughly eliminated to help ensure highly accurate measurement in minute detail.

Reliable Measurements with a Stone Stage-Mounting Plate

To further improve measurement accuracy, the STM7 series uses a highly durable, vibration-resistant frame with a granite surface plate. This stability enables sub-micron level measurements with minimal error.

Precisely Control Light Intensity Values with a Quantitative Digital Display

The STM7 series displays light intensity using quantitative digital display, enabling observations to be made under consistent illumination conditions.

No More Manual Adjustments

The light intensity manager can be used with the coded revolving nosepiece configuration. The coded revolving nosepiece automatically detects when you change objectives. This allows the illumination method and light intensity to be registered for each objective and adjusted automatically during measurements when the objective is switched. Now, there is no need to manually adjust light intensity, which used to be required with every switch between magnifications.

Simple, Precise Focusing System with Superior Repeatability

Olympus’ focus navigator delivers highly reproducible height measurement by projecting a pattern within the field of view and identifying vertical deviations. Slight errors can occur in height measurements taken with normal visual observation, even when focus appears to be sharp. The focus navigator, however, enables measurements to be made simply by matching up the marks, reducing operator subjectivity in measurement results.

Dedicated Autofocus Unit: Outstanding Reproducibility and Focusing Speed

The STM7 autofocus unit allows highly accurate height measurements to be made with minimal time, regardless of the level of operator experience. Use of the reflective active, confocal method provides a stable focal point independent of surface roughness or a slanting sample surface, while the small laser diameter enables the use of autofocus, even on minute objects, such as bonding wires.

One-Shot Mode

Instantaneously takes autofocus from roughly focused to sharply focused at the center of the field of view.

TRACK Mode

The TRACK Mode provides autofocus that tracks the peaks and troughs of the sample, even if the stage is moved, keeping the image continually in focus. This advancement greatly improves the efficiency of Z-axis measurements by enabling observations to be made without taking your hands off the X and Y handles.
